The petitioner is presently pursuing the MBBS course in the Jorhat Medical College under Srimanta Sankaradeva University of Health Sciences in 3rd Page No.# 3/4 Professional MBBS (Part-I). He was admitted on 03.07.2014 and presently he has passed the 6th Semester out of total 9 Semesters.
The petitioner is aggrieved by the Communication dated 20.02.2024 issued by the Controller of Examination, Srimanta Sankaradeva University of Health Sciences and addressed to the Principal, Jorhat Medical College, Jorhat, wherein it was informed that the petitioner along with two other MBBS students cannot appear in any further MBBS Examination as per NMC Regulations.
